# Compaction settings for the Brindlequeue broker.
# Compaction merges duplicate keys in retained segments; support staff
# should never disable it on a live partition. If disk alarms fire,
# check segment age before touching thresholds. Defaults suit most
# tenants. The current tuning constants follow.

tuning constants:
RATE_LIMITS = {
    "wenwyn": 1,
    "zorix": 10,
    "oliix": 2,
    "holael": 10,
}

- [ ] Verify the Kestrelgate signing node stays connected during the ceremony. The websocket reconnect bug in relay v2.4 drops the session after idle timeouts, so keep the console active. If the node disconnects mid-signing, abort, restart the relay, and re-enroll. Re-enrollment requires unsealing the standby keystore, and the passphrase for that is printed below.

strongbox words: zorath-holmir

# Tidemark widget — production env
# On-call notes: this file feeds the tide-table widget embedded on the
# Harborline portal. POLL_INTERVAL_MIN controls how often we fetch new
# tide predictions; keep it at 15 unless the upstream feed is degraded.
# STATION_SET lists the invented harbor stations we render. If the widget
# shows stale tides, restart the fetcher before editing anything here.
# The upstream prediction feed requires an access credential, which is
# set on the line immediately below.

vault entry, yahif-yajep: COURIER_KEY29=b802bdf8034096b65a51c6ba5abe2